.elementor-kit-8{--e-global-color-primary:#111111;--e-global-color-secondary:#F0F2F4;--e-global-color-text:#333333;--e-global-color-accent:#F14F44;--e-global-typography-primary-font-family:"Roboto";--e-global-typography-primary-font-weight:600;--e-global-typography-secondary-font-family:"Roboto Slab";--e-global-typography-secondary-font-weight:400;--e-global-typography-text-font-family:"Roboto";--e-global-typography-text-font-weight:400;--e-global-typography-accent-font-family:"Roboto";--e-global-typography-accent-font-weight:500;}.elementor-section.elementor-section-boxed > .elementor-container{max-width:1340px;}.e-con{--container-max-width:1340px;}.elementor-widget:not(:last-child){margin-block-end:20px;}.elementor-element{--widgets-spacing:20px 20px;}{}h1.entry-title{display:var(--page-title-display);}.elementor-kit-8 e-page-transition{background-color:#FFBC7D;}@media(max-width:991px){.elementor-section.elementor-section-boxed > .elementor-container{max-width:1024px;}.e-con{--container-max-width:1024px;}}@media(max-width:575px){.elementor-section.elementor-section-boxed > .elementor-container{max-width:767px;}.e-con{--container-max-width:767px;}}/* Start custom CSS */.header .main-menu > li ul.sub-menu {
    width: 350px;
}

.header-row .header-icons-container {
    margin: 10px 20px
}

.mobile-header-menu-container .neuros-button {
    color: #ffffff;
}

.zelai-slideshow {
    margin: 15px 20px;
    height: calc(100% - 30px);
}

.zelai-top-video .elementor-background-overlay {
    z-index: 1
}

.logo-link img {
    width: 85px !important;
}

.header nav{
    text-align: right
}

.header .neuros-button {
    color: #ffffff;
}

.header .main-menu > li > a:hover, .header .mini-cart:hover .mini-cart-trigger {
    background-color: #ffffff;
    color: black;
}

.header-row {
    height: 90px
}

.owl-dots .owl-dot.active span, .owl-dots .owl-dot span:after, .neuros-audio-listing .audio-item-wrapper .audio-item:hover, .neuros-audio-listing .audio-item-wrapper .audio-item.active {
    border-color: #c0c0c0;
}

@media only screen and (min-width: 992px) {
    .footer-type-3 .footer-widgets > .widget {
        width: calc(20% - 30px) !important;
    }
}

@media (max-width: 991px) {
    .zelai-slideshow {
        height: unset;
    }
}

@media (max-width: 1364px) {
    .logo-link img {
        width: 40px;
    }
}/* End custom CSS */